William Munny was a thief and murderer of “notoriously vicious and intemperate disposition.” But he reformed and settled into a life of peace. He takes 1 last task: to avenge a woman who’d been assaulted and mutilated. Her attacker has been given cover because of the tyrannical sheriff of the small town (Gene Hackman), who’s so decided to “civilize” the untamed landscape in his very own way (“I’m creating a house,” he repeatedly declares) he lets all kinds of injustices happen on his watch, so long as his possess power is safe. Most American audiences had never seen anything quite like the Wachowski siblings’ signature cinematic experience when “The Matrix” arrived in theaters in the spring of 1999. A glorious mash-up in the pair’s long-time obsessions — everything from cyberpunk parables to kung fu action, brain-bending philosophy into the instantly inconic impact known as “bullet time” — number of aueturs have ever delivered such a vivid vision (times two!
